1). German peace terms were handed to French officials in Compiègne today. The French are studying the terms. We have no information as to what they are. Only the preamble has been made available. An effort was made to reproduce the exact conditions using the same RR car in the same spot as was used in 1918.


2). Germans may have seized two French battleships in production.

3). British planes continue to attack German forces throughout Europe.

4). Italians warn U.S. against participating in the war.

5). Isolationists in U.S. protest reselling of materials to France. Senator Nye demands that FDR resign.
